philadelphia - Leaders of the Republican Party, including President Donald Trump will, on Wednesday in the city of Philadelphia gathered for a three-day deliberation in which the US government policy should be determined in the coming period.

The main topics on the agenda are the abolition of Obamacare and tax reform. In addition, the British Prime Minister on Thursday May visit is to discuss a possible American-British trade deal.

The construction of the wall on the border with Mexico and the easing of the rules for banks on the agenda. During the discussions, many lawyers are present to examine the legislative proposals and changes. The followers of Trump in the House of Representatives called the president to make quick changes.

A Republican insider said he does not expect there will be a new Health in the short term instead of the 'Affordable Care Act' of Obama. Moderate Republicans call Trump to be especially careful with the revision of Obamacare. According to them, 20 million Americans run the risk of losing their health insurance if the new law is not made properly.

What President Trump wants exactly with the new law is still unknown, he gave away about the last time different signals. His spokeswoman Kelly Anne Conway promised Sunday that no one will fall by the wayside in the new law.
